The 1988 television series, Mahabharat, was a groundbreaking production that brought the ancient epic to life on the small screen. The show was known for its engaging storytelling, memorable characters, and high production values. It was a collaborative effort between B.R. Chopra and his son, Ravi Chopra, who worked tirelessly to recreate the magic of the Mahabharat for a modern audience.

The specific terminology used in the search query—"fixed" and "complete"—reveals the technical challenges faced by digital archivists and pirates alike. In the early days of internet file sharing, episodes of Mahabharat were ripped from VHS tapes or low-quality television broadcasts. These files were often plagued by issues: audio sync problems, missing scenes, cropped aspect ratios, or episodes split arbitrarily to fit CD-R limits.
